Reasons to consider the Intel Xeon E-2324G

  • Around 28% higher clock speed: 4.60 GHz vs 3.60 GHz
  • Around 11% higher maximum core temperature: 100 °C vs 90°C
  • 2.1x lower typical power consumption: 65 Watt vs 135 Watt
  • Around 41% better performance in PassMark - Single thread mark: 2953 vs 2092

Reasons to consider the Intel Xeon E5-2698 v4

  • 16 more cores, run more applications at once: 20 vs 4
  • 36 more threads: 40 vs 4
  • 12x more maximum memory size: 1.5 TB vs 128 GB
  • 4x better performance in PassMark - CPU mark: 39207 vs 9771
